Tyler Cornack's (2020) is a film that defies its juvenile title by being a surprisingly disciplined, self-serious noir-procedural that treats its absurd premise with the gravity of a Scorsese thriller .

The story follows Chip Gutchel, a bored IT worker who has a spiritual awakening during a prostate exam . This sparks a compulsive addiction to inserting increasingly large objects into his rectum—which appears to have developed its own gravitational pull .
